Milestone: 8 million Jiefang J7 trucks produced

A significant milestone was passed on Tuesday as a Jiefang J7 truck rolled off the assembly line at FAW Jiefang Automotive Co in Changchun, Jilin province. It was truck No 8 million for the company, an independent Chinese brand.

FAW Jiefang, a truck subsidiary of China's leading automaker FAW Group, produced China's first Jiefang commercial truck in 1956. In 1958, the first Dongfeng car and first Hongqi luxury sedan rolled off the assembly line.

FAW Jiefang produced 267,770 complete vehicles in the first half of this year, an increase of 15.3 percent year-on-year, and sold 339,230 trucks, up 21.9 percent year-on-year.

"FAW Jiefang is in the best stage of development in its history," said Hu Hanjie, president of the company. "We will firmly adhere to the principles of independent development, opening-up and cooperation and strive to become China's first century-old automobile brand."
